Food In My Culture: Teagan


Christmas

I am from Niue and one of the major celebrations we love to do is Christmas. My family loves to celebrate Christmas. We always start off at home and then go to my Nana’s house. My Mum always makes the best food. My brothers and I always get excited for the presents.  We have a big lunch so my Mum and Dad prepare a lot of things the day before.

My Mum and Dad always prepare some of the food on Christmas Eve. My Dad always marinades the meats. My mum also does her chicken which is so good, as if it is from KFC. She also does her mussel chowder and the rest of her seafoods.  My brothers and I always make sure that there is some cookies and a glass of milk, and that our stockings are up. When my brothers fall asleep I eat two of the cookies and bite one in half and drink all the milk. My mum fills up the stockings with a lot of chocolates and heaps of lollies. They just can’t wait for Christmas.

Now usually my brothers sleep in, but because it is Christmas, they are up extra early.  They are running and screaming down the hallway screaming “Its Christmas! Its Christmas!” They wake me up. They dash to their presents and they are very happy. As my Mum and Dad have already prepared the food, all they have to do is cook it.  My brothers and I eat our chocolate and lollies then I tell them that Santa has been here, because he has eaten the cookies.

Once lunch it ready we all go and eat. We have Ham (cold), ribs, crispy chicken, prawns, crab salad and my dad’s favourite thing to cook, is chicken curry.  Then we eat the rest of our lollies. My Mum and Dad pack some of the food and we get ready to take it to our Nana’s.

We always take food down to my Nana’s. Our aunties, uncles, cousins always bring food so we have a big feast. Every Christmas our family has a big party and we celebrate. Sometimes we have presents for other family members or we are celebrating someone coming back from overseas. My Nana would always give my brothers and I the best presents, because we see her all the time. She would also give us lollies too, so we would have lollies for breakfast, lollies for lunch, and lollies for dinner.

My family loves to celebrate Christmas. My mum always makes the best food, so starts making it the night before. My brothers and I always get excited for the presents, and that’s why I love Christmas.
